Product Description
The PARKER Barbed Fitting Elbow is a low-lead brass barbed tube fitting with a 1/2 in ID x 3/8 in ID size, featuring a Barbed x MNPT connection, rigid construction, and standard barb design (MPN L129HB-8-4).

What is the PARKER L129HB-8-4 barbed fitting elbow used for?
The PARKER L129HB-8-4 is a low-lead brass barbed fitting elbow used to connect tubing to male NPT threads in industrial fluid systems. It is suitable for pneumatic, hydraulic, and water applications where a rigid, leak-resistant joint is required.
What are the specifications of the PARKER L129HB-8-4?
The PARKER L129HB-8-4 is a rigid, standard barb elbow fitting with a 1/2 in ID x 3/8 in ID size. It features a barbed x MNPT connection, is made of low-lead brass, and is designed for reliable sealing in industrial fluid handling systems.

How to install a PARKER barbed fitting elbow?
To install the PARKER L129HB-8-4, push the tubing fully onto the barbed end until seated, then tighten the male NPT thread into the port using a wrench on the fitting hex. Avoid over-tightening to prevent damage. Always verify compatibility with your fluid and pressure requirements.
